Age 54, of Shaler Twp., on Saturday, October 4, 2025, Marsha was the beloved daughter of James W. McDevitt, and the late Carol A. McDevitt; sister of Diane McDevitt (Marilyn), Cheryl Ford (Curt), Donna Lotz (Carl), Colleen Rekowski (Tom); aunt of Erin Alvarez (Miguel), Justin Druga (Andrew); great-aunt of Emmy.
Celebrate Marsha’s life with her family on Thursday from 2-4 PM and 6-8 PM at PERMAN FUNERAL HOME AND CREMATION SERVICES, INC., 923 Saxonburg Blvd. Mass of Christian Burial at St. Mary of the Assumption Church on Friday at 10:30 AM. The family respectfully suggests donations to be made to PA Connecting Communities, 800 N. Bell Ave., Ste 200, Carnegie PA 15106.
